On behalf of a client, we are seeking a program specialist to support the implementation of large-scale, federally funded public sector energy programs. This individual will play a vital role in managing the day-to-day activities of key energy programs and ensuring compliance with federal guidelines.
This role is on-site based in Baton Rouge, Louisiana; it is expected to begin on a part-time basis with the potential to expand into a full-time position based on program needs.
Key responsibilities include but are not limited to:
- Managing the daily administration and coordination of federally funded energy programs, ensuring tasks are completed efficiently and in compliance with program guidelines
- Coordinating and facilitating effective communication between program leadership, staff, and federal project managers, responding to information requests, and supporting program needs
- Reviewing and evaluating subrecipient applications, ensuring eligibility and alignment with program objectives
- Providing ongoing support to program leadership, contractors, and subrecipients, including guidance on federal and state requirements, compliance, and reporting
- Reviewing invoices and supporting documentation to ensure compliance with federal cost principles, approved budgets, and scopes of work, and identifying discrepancies or unallowable costs for resolution
- Tracking program budgets across all projects, contractors, and subrecipients, conducting monthly and quarterly reconciliations to ensure accuracy and fiscal compliance, in addition to reviewing and processing invoices submitted by subrecipients to verify alignment with approved budgets and deliverables
- Preparing and submitting quarterly performance and financial reports, summarizing progress and key metrics across all funded projects
- Conducting site visits to monitor performance and ensure compliance with grant requirements
- Monitoring program compliance and implementing corrective actions, as needed, to ensure adherence to federal and state guidelines
Minimum qualifications include:
- Bachelor’s degree in public administration, political science, business administration, or a related field
- At least two years of experience managing or supporting federally funded programs or grants
- Knowledge of managing federal energy grants considered a plus
- Strong organizational skills and attention to detail, particularly in budgeting and compliance monitoring
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ills with the ability to interact with a variety of stakeholders, including federal agencies, program leadership, subrecipients, contractors, and internal teams
- Ability to work independently, manage multiple priorities, and meet deadlines in a dynamic environment
